Heard Sri Rajesh Kumar, learned counsel for the petitioner.
In view of the order proposed to be passed, this Court does not deem it necessary to issue notice to respondents as their interest would be well protected by the order passed by this Court.
By means of the present petition, the petitioner has prayed for the following reliefs:-
"(i) Direct the Opposite Party No.1 to decide the Suit for Declaration of Right and Dispossession in Regular Suit No.442 of 2002(Ramteerath versus Sageer and others) pending before the Opposite party No.1 since 2002, expeditiously within stipulated time.
(ii) Issue any other suitable, order or direction as the Hon'ble Court may deem just and proper in the circumstances of the case.
(iii) To allow the petition with costs throughout."
This court on administrative side has already issued directions to the court below to obtain zero pendency of cases which are more than five years old. In view of directions already issued on administrative side, this court is not inclined to pass any further order on judicial side.
However, it is always open for the petitioner to move appropriate application before the court before which the matter is pending for expeditious hearing. In case any such application is moved within a week from today the same shall be considered and disposed of within two weeks thereafter and endeavour shall be made to decide the Suit within a time frame.
With the aforesaid, the petition is disposed of. .
